Knowledge Retention via a role-starting documentation kit

A role-starting documentation kit is a structured knowledge retention tool that captures critical professional, operational, and cultural expertise for new or transitioning employees. By engaging senior, mid-level, and new staff in mapping, documenting, and learning processes, organizations ensure faster onboarding, continuity, and reduced risk of knowledge loss. Developing a Framework for Knowledge Management for Global Projects - Book Review

Developing a Framework for Knowledge Management for Global Projects shows that global project success depends on combining knowledge management, communication, and collaboration across cultures, virtual teams, and distributed stakeholders. Its practical value lies in offering a framework for capturing, sharing, and reusing project knowledge to improve coordination, reduce risk, and strengthen outcomes in international projects. Business Intelligence Roadmap – Book Review

Business Intelligence Roadmap presents BI as a disciplined, end-to-end methodology for turning business needs into data-driven decision support. Its practical value lies in showing how to justify, plan, design, build, and release BI environments systematically, helping organizations reduce project risk, improve data quality, and deliver usable analytics in manageable iterations.
